Output f43a695e6f08d80634c6b8f21c2934cf0d6cf0b54c7f336d2973a8239b2d0be2:1

value
4410929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84db6e2325e06ff3321716d4c76f6b9c5685ff23 OP_EQUAL
address
3DoVz9LhrHjESNhys2Vw8CpDwpQYVgTueB
transaction
f43a695e6f08d80634c6b8f21c2934cf0d6cf0b54c7f336d2973a8239b2d0be2
confirmations
296855
spent
true